About The Position

The Unit Clerk - Perinatal is responsible for coordinating the various activities on the unit, including greeting and directing visitors, patients, physicians, and staff. This role involves assisting with new admissions and discharges/transfers, ensuring patient charts are accurate and up-to-date, and supporting the nursing staff with non-clinical duties such as managing equipment and supplies for patients and the unit.

Responsibilities

  • Greets patients and visitors at the desk in a friendly, courteous manner, presenting a positive image and directing them to appropriate areas.
  • Provides timely notification for absence or tardiness and demonstrates flexibility in work schedule to meet unit needs.
  • Coordinates patient admissions, including completing admission documents, assisting with room assignments, initiating medical records, and notifying nurses of stat orders.
  • Coordinates patient discharge/transfer, preparing medical records and taking them to HIS after discharge.
  • Answers the telephone efficiently and courteously, relaying messages and calls to appropriate personnel and patients, and answering patient intercoms promptly.
  • Processes physician orders, ensuring completion of orders/stat orders, notifying nurses of new orders, and referring telephone and verbal orders to nurses.
  • Coordinates patient activities, noting departures and returns, notifying other departments of status changes, and assisting nursing staff with obtaining equipment or supplies.
  • Maintains medical records in an orderly manner, notifying nurses of missing information, keeping charts supplied with forms, and ensuring all forms have an ID label.
  • Operates copy and fax machines.
  • Makes appointments for patients and arranges transportation as requested.
  • Assists the Unit Director with data collection for Quality Improvement (QI) studies.
  • Monitors patients' charts for history, physicals, consents, and other important documents.
  • Keeps the desk stocked with needed clerical supplies.
  • Initiates and monitors work orders for Facility Engineering and Clinical Engineering.
  • Participates in monthly department staff meetings and unit clerk meetings, completing mandatory and recommended in-services.
  • Answers patient call lights and assists with patients as appropriate.
